“I invest in enterprise with a focus on cloud-native infrastructure, developer tools, and data engineering. I help founders with product and go-to-market strategy, bottoms-up adoption, open-source commercialization, and enterprise product-market fit.”
Vivek is an experienced investor and product leader in enterprise infrastructure and product development software.
Vivek brings deep product management experience in commercial and open-source ecosystems at both early startups and large enterprises. Vivek launched Docker’s primary enterprise product and grew to hundreds of customers and eight figures revenue. Prior to that, he launched the Storage for Cloud Native Applications initiative at VMware and built new storage features at Amazon Web Services. In a previous life, Vivek was an early engineer at Solexel, a venture-backed solar power startup, and managed semiconductor partnerships at Applied Materials.
Vivek received his BS and MS in Materials Science and Engineering and his MBA from Stanford University. In his spare time, he enjoys singing in both a cappella groups and rock bands.
